Description
Summary:A chopper amplification technique has been developed to correct zero drift when measuring the magnitude of the piezoelectric response using the PFM method under conditions of continuous temperature change. Employing this technique, the temperatures of the antiferroelectric – ferroelectric phase transition of a PZT 4% single crystal were obtained. A qualitative agreement with the results of measuring the saturation polarization obtained by the Sawyer – Tower method makes it possible to assert that the technical assumptions made are quite reasonable and the developed method is worthy of widespread use in such measurements.
